A Spanish Colonial silver small covered pot, Guatemala, late 18th century

Description
- marked on base with Guatemala mark and crown tax mark
- silver, wood
- height of first 3 3/4 in.
- 9.5 cm
bulbous form with turned wood handle, the base engraved with initials. Together with a shell-form baptismal scoop, marked twice with crown tax mark, and a thurible chased with matted stylized foliage, the cover pierced, marked with crown tax mark on rim of cover and base and on canopy. 3 pieces.
Provenance
Shell scoop: Sotheby's, New York, November 22, 1993, lot 104
Condition
the pot and scoop good; the thurible with section of base rim missing, damaged where chains go through cover
